[0082] By testing the production contract data of a cold rolling finishing unit in a large iron and steel enterprise from June 7 to 22, 2007, the specific method steps are as follows:

[0083] Step 1: Establish an initial population of 100 solutions according to the heuristic method. This heuristic method combines greedy and random strategies, that is, first randomly selects a contract to be adjusted, calculates the objective function value of the contract produced by each unit, selects the unit with the largest objective function value, and then randomly selects another contract to repeat Until all the contracts to be adjusted select production units, an initial solution is obtained. After obtaining an initial solution through the above heuristic, randomly select a contract again, and then obtain a solution according to the heuristic method, so as to obtain the required initial population of 100 solutions in turn.

Abstract

The invention discloses a method for balancing the capacity load of a cold rolling finishing unit in an iron and steel enterprise, and relates to the technical field of automation. The method comprises the following steps: (1) downloading the batch coiled sheet data in a data warehouse of the iron and steel enterprise; (2) judging whether the present capacity condition of the cold rolling finishing unit need balance adjustment, comparing the number of days T which is needed for producing the monthly batch coiled sheets by the cold rolling finishing unit with the remaining number of days of the month tr, and adjusting the batch coiled sheet if the T is greater than tr; (3) determining the batch coiled sheets to be adjusted based on the production technologies and the constraints of the cold rolling finishing unit and the related upstream and downstream units; (4) establishing an mathematical model for balancing and optimizing the capacity of the cold rolling finishing unit by taking the batch coiled sheets to be adjusted as objects; (5) solving the mathematical model for balancing and optimizing the capacity of the unit by a scatter search method, and determining the optimized adjustment strategy of the batch coiled sheets; and (6) displaying the optimized adjustment results by a graph mode and a data mode. The method can help find out problems in the capacity of the unit in advance, and is applied to the production process of the cold rolling finishing unit.

Description

technical field [0001] The invention belongs to the technical field of cold-rolling and finishing production in iron and steel enterprises, relates to automation technology, and in particular relates to a method for balancing production capacity and load of cold-rolling and finishing units in iron and steel enterprises. Background technique [0002] The cold rolling and finishing unit of iron and steel enterprises undertakes the task of producing finished products of cold rolled high-quality steel coils (plates) after annealing, galvanizing, and tinning. The specific work is to press the steel coils (plates) from the previous process into Users request to cut into steel plates, narrow gauge steel coils or smaller steel coils, and do surface treatment and oiled packaging. In terms of machine settings, cold rolling and finishing units can be subdivided into specialized cross-cutting units, slitting units and recoiling units.
